Lockheed Martin F-35 Lightning II simulator visit Yokota
Commander of the Medical Support Squadron, Lt Col. Christopher Estridge, tests out the F-35 Lightning II simulator from Lockheed Martin at Yokota Air Base, Japan, Sept. 29, 2014. Some of the capabilities the F-35 has to offer is it's stealth, sensor information fusion and network-enabled operations. (U.S. Air Force photo by Airman 1st Class Meagan Schutter/Released)
